Huge! Look what Nonno built for his grandchildren (5 photos)
Monday, March 04, 2013 by: SooToday.com Staff

"As most of the Sault residents moan about the abundance of snow, my father (otherwise affectionately known as Nonno) decided to make the best of it and create something fun for his grandkids," loyal reader Tricia Lesnick tells us in an e-mail.
"He spent the winter months blowing the snow from the driveway and walkways into a large mound in his backyard. Over the past few weeks, he moulded it into a snowman and created a face using items like a basketball for a nose, and ping pong paddles for ears. Of course, what good would it be if you couldn’t play on it as well so he build a snow slide off the back. Needless to say, my two children were ecstatic yesterday as they reaped the benefits of Nonno’s winter project. This weekend’s project is giving him a name. If we’re going to have a long winter this year, we might as well enjoy it!"
